A bit too fancy for my taste. Porcelain is not very sturdy ( bitter experience at the kitchen...), and tends to make it rather decorative.
The form of the handle is peculiar; perhaps real, perhaps... from other source? And, indeed, the contrast between the elaborate handle, gold ornament on the blade and rather cheap ( although old!) scabbard is suspicious. It doesn't tickle me. But, again, "De gustibus..." |
